  • Sensitivity (1W, 1m, infinite baffle) SPL1W 88.7dB
  • Frequency response 40 - 6200Hz

Thiele & Small parameters

  • Resonance frequency (free air) fS 41.8Hz
  • Mechanical quality factor QMS 5.54
  • Electrical quality factor QES 1.32
  • Total quality factor QTS 1.07

Large signal parameters

  • Power handling P 110W
  • Program power Pmax 220W

Voice Coil

  • Nominal impedance Z 4Ω
  • DC resistance RE 3.8Ω
  • Inductance (1kHz) LE 0.4mH
  • VC Diameter 38.1mm
  • Winding material Aluminum

Magnet

  • Force factor Bl 5.31N/A
  • Motor constant Bl/√RE 2.72N/√W
  • Weight 0.567kg

Diaphragm

  • Effective diameter 210mm
  • Effective area SD 345cm²
  • Moving mass MMS 37.7g
  • Moving mass (without air load) MMD 33.1g
  • Material Poly

Suspensions

  • Stiffness KMS 2.6N/mm
  • Compliance CMS 384µm/N
  • Equivalent volume to the compliance VAS 64.2L
  • Mechanical resistance RMS 1.79N·s/m
  • Surround material Rolled Foam

Dimensions

  • Nominal diameter 10
  • 254mm
  • Overall diameter 254mm
  • Baffle cutout diameter 235mm
  • Mounting depth 102mm
  • Volume occupied by the driver (estimated) 0.74L
  • Net weight 1.814kg
  • Frame material Stamped Steel
